So my contract for my Sidekick is ending, and I'm thinking of getting an iPhone. The plan I have right now on my Sidekick is a data plan where I have unlimited internet use, texting, AIM acess, etc. I don't even have a phone plan, I rarely talk on the phone, mostly texting, so I just pay $.20 a minute. Is there a plan like this for iPhones? Any tips for newbies? Thank you.

The cheapest plan for the iPhone is $69.99 for 450 minutes (no texting included). To add unlimited texting, it's another $20 per month.

Is the iPhone worth the increased cost? I think it is.
